Understanding Volatility and RTP

Before diving into any of these games, it’s important to understand the concepts of volatility and Return to Player (RTP). Volatility refers to the level of risk involved; high volatility games offer larger, but less frequent, payouts, while low volatility games provide smaller, more consistent wins. RTP, expressed as a percentage, represents the average amount of money a game returns to players over the long term. A higher RTP generally indicates a more favorable game for players. While these metrics don’t guarantee winnings, they provide valuable insight into the game's characteristics and can help you make informed decisions. Researching the volatility and RTP of a game before you play is a smart move for any serious player.

  • High Volatility: Large potential wins, but infrequent.
  • Low Volatility: Frequent, smaller wins.
  • RTP: Percentage of wagers returned to players over time.

Bankroll Management Techniques

Effective bankroll management is the cornerstone of responsible gaming. A common technique is to divide your total bankroll into smaller units and wager only a small percentage of that unit on each spin. This helps to mitigate the risk of losing your entire bankroll quickly. Another strategy is to set win and loss limits. If you reach your win limit, cash out and enjoy your profits. Conversely, if you reach your loss limit, stop playing and avoid the temptation to chase your losses. These simple strategies can help you maintain control and enjoy the game responsibly.

  1. Set a budget and stick to it.
  2. Divide your bankroll into smaller units.
  3. Wager only a small percentage of your unit per spin.
  4. Set win and loss limits.
